'Landman' Season 3: What we know about Billy Bob Thornton-led show

TL;DR

Landman has been officially renewed for a third season, with Billy Bob Thornton confirmed to return in the lead role. Production is expected to begin shortly, but specific release dates and plot details are still unannounced.

Landman Season 3 has been officially renewed, with Billy Bob Thornton confirmed to reprise his role as the titular character. The show’s creators announced that production will begin shortly, marking the next chapter in the popular series that has garnered a dedicated following.

According to sources close to the production, filming for Landman Season 3 is scheduled to start in the coming weeks. The series, created by Taylor Sheridan, centers on the life of a landman navigating the complexities of oil and gas negotiations in Texas.

While the renewal has been confirmed, specific details about the season’s plot, episode count, and premiere date have not yet been disclosed by the producers or network. The series is expected to continue exploring themes of power, morality, and the economic stakes of land deals.

Why the Return of Landman Matters for Fans and the Industry

The renewal of Landman for a third season underscores the show’s popularity and its importance within Taylor Sheridan’s expanding TV universe. Billy Bob Thornton’s return is significant because it maintains continuity for fans and signals confidence from the producers. The series’ focus on regional issues like land rights and energy development resonates with audiences interested in American industry and regional storytelling, making it a noteworthy addition to Sheridan’s portfolio of successful dramas.

Landman’s Development and Its Place in Sheridan’s TV Portfolio

Landman debuted on television in 2022 and quickly gained a following for its gritty portrayal of land negotiations and complex characters. Created by Taylor Sheridan, known for Yellowstone and other hit series, it fits into Sheridan’s pattern of producing regional, character-driven dramas that explore American frontier themes.

The show’s first season received positive reviews for its writing and performances, particularly Thornton’s portrayal of the seasoned landman. Its renewal for a second season was announced in early 2023, with subsequent episodes further expanding the series’ narrative universe.

As of now, the show’s renewal for a third season was confirmed in March 2024, with production scheduled to start soon, indicating ongoing confidence in its storytelling and audience appeal.

“We’re excited to bring Landman back for a third season. Billy Bob Thornton’s performance continues to be a cornerstone of the series, and we look forward to exploring new stories in this world.”

— Taylor Sheridan, series creator
